How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Village Of Palmetto Bay?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Village Of Palmetto Bay Gated Studio Apartments | $2,214 | $1,170 | $4,337 |
Village Of Palmetto Bay Gated 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,300 | $950 | $5,564 |
Village Of Palmetto Bay Gated 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,884 | $1,620 | $5,554 |
Village Of Palmetto Bay Gated 3 Bedroom Apartments | $3,410 | $1,765 | $7,511 |
Village Of Palmetto Bay Gated 4 Bedroom Apartments | $6,373 | $3,600 | $10,000+ |

Frequently Asked Questions about Gated Village Of Palmetto Bay Apartments
What is the Cheapest Gated apartment in Village Of Palmetto Bay?
Currently the most affordable Gated Apartment in Village Of Palmetto Bay is at Cabana Club listed at $1,211.
How much is the average rent for a Gated Village Of Palmetto Bay Apartment?
The average rent for a Gated Apartment in Village Of Palmetto Bay is $2,709.
What is the largest Gated Village Of Palmetto Bay Apartment for rent?
Today's Gated apartment with the most square footage in Village Of Palmetto Bay is a 2,405 square feet unit starting from $2,528 at AMLI Joya.
What is the average size for Village Of Palmetto Bay Gated Apartments for rent?
The average size for a Gated rental in Village Of Palmetto Bay is currently at 616 sq ft.
